TittleBitties said:"For over a decade, Blink-182 has toured, recorded and done non-stop promotion all while trying to balance relationships with family and friends.
To that end, the band has decided to go on an indefinite hiatus to spend some time enjoying the fruits of their labors with their loved ones. While there is no set plan for the band to begin working together again, no one knows what tomorrow may bring."

http://suicidegirls.com/news/music/7258/Rock guitar virtuoso Dave Navarro (Jane’s Addiction, Red Hot Chili Peppers) issued an apology to pop-punkers Blink 182 this sunday, after falsely reporting that the trio had broken up. Navarro and Blink were slated to play a Tsunami Relief concert on Friday, the 18th, and when Blink pulled out at the last minute, it was announced that they had broken up.
